Up for sale is my beautiful Compass Rose tenor. I bought it from another UU member and he bought it new from Gryphon Stringed Instruments. It is nicely setup with a low comfortable action. I really really really don't want to sell this but it was an impulse buy to replace a Compass Rose that I sold two years ago and sadly it has sat in it's case because I haven't installed a pickup in it for gigging. I need the money more than I need this ukulele so it's time to pass it on.

The top and back are both made of single pieces of curly koa. The fretboard and bridge are both made of ebony. Bone nut and saddle. Ebony binding front and back. Mahagony neck. Side sound port. Cantilevered fretboard. Gold Gotoh geared tuners. Aquila low g strings. Ebony heel cap. Strap button. Comes with gig bag shown.
